While “AGI” often sounds like science fiction, the logic behind Altman’s AGI prediction is rooted in “Agentic AI.” This refers to systems that do not just provide information but execute actions. When a model can navigate a computer interface as a human does, the distinction between software and a digital employee vanishes. The “collapse” Altman refers to is the obsolescence of the current labor-for-income exchange model.

The Socio-Economic Impact

For the Pakistani citizen, this development represents a massive baseline shift. Our economy, heavily reliant on freelance knowledge work and IT services, must pivot. As GPT-5.5 masters coding and data entry, Pakistani students must transition from learning “how to code” to “how to architect AI systems.” In rural areas, the digital divide could widen unless structural educational reforms integrate these precision tools into local curricula.
